WebSep 17, 2024 · Both are correct depending on the context and expression. "Seeing is believing" is used without a subject or object, as a general observation/comment. --> "Why don't you believe what I'm saying?" / "Well, seeing is believing." --> "I'll need to see it to believe it!" --> "She said she won't believe it until she sees it."

WebDec 14, 2013 · 1. "I don't/didn't want to believe it," implies something so unpleasant that it is difficult to allow that such a thing could happen. When I heard about the train derailing, I didn't want to believe it.
